In 2016, American National Bank & Trust implemented JHA PayCenter, a Payment Processing application from Jack Henry & Associates. The deployment was integrated with the Banno Digital Platform and enabled the bank to join the RTP network through its collaboration with Jack Henry, aligning payment rails with the bank's digital channel strategy.
The implementation centered on real time payment flows and in‑app payment initiation, embedding JHA PayCenter within the Banno Digital Platform to present a seamless consumer payment experience. Functional capabilities emphasized Payment Processing workflows for real time clearing and confirmation, payment orchestration between digital banking and back‑office systems, and customer facing status updates within the mobile and online banking channels.
Operational scope covered retail digital banking and front office channels, with impacts on consumer payments operations, product management, and marketing. Governance and process changes focused on operationalizing real time payment handling and incorporating RTP into the bank's digital roadmap, consistent with the bank’s stated objective to simplify operations and the customer experience as articulated by Carolyn Kiser.
The bank positioned JHA PayCenter and the integrated RTP capability as a faster, integrated payment option inside its digital banking app, intended to simplify money movement for customers and support the bank’s goal of becoming the primary app customers use for financial needs.

In 2016 American National Bank & Trust implemented Jack Henry Banking SilverLake as its Core Banking platform, engaging Jack Henry & Associates for the bank core system. The implementation was positioned to support the bank’s retail and commercial lending operations and to consolidate account and loan processing onto a single vendor-supplied core.
The Jack Henry Banking SilverLake deployment was integrated with the bank’s existing lending applications, including LaserPro, DecisionPro, and LawyerPro, leveraging the jxchange SilverLake Interface to orchestrate data flows between the core and lending systems. Configuration work emphasized account and loan processing workflows, interface orchestration, and role-based access controls consistent with Core Banking architectures.
Operational coverage included day-to-day application administration and support functions performed from the bank’s Danville, VA environment, with responsibilities for user administration add changes and deletes, monitoring and responding to application support tickets, and assigning emailed loan document requests to a Loan Documentation Specialist. Release management and upgrade activities were coordinated with Jack Henry & Associates and business users, with planned testing and troubleshooting of software updates.
Governance and process changes centered on formalizing application support and knowledge management, the LaserPro Support Coordinator role maintained a service request list, developed help desk knowledge base documents, produced end user training documentation, and liaised with IT for technical issue resolution and prioritization of requests. These controls supported ongoing application stability and business process alignment across lending and IT teams.
